26 CRPF jawans killed in Naxal attack
Raipur, Jun 30: In a ferocious attack on the security personnel, Maoists killed 26 Central Reserve Police Force (CRPF) personnel and injured several others in the Narayanpur district of Chattisgarh on Tuesday, Jun 29.
The incident took place three kilometres away from the CRPF camp in Dhaurai on the road which leads to densely forested Naxal controlled Abhujhmad area. 63 CRPF jawans were attacked near a drain in the Dhaurai forest area. The jawans were returning after a road-opening party.
Naxals used guns instead of landmines to attack the jawans, reported police officials. They opened fire from a hilltop on the road opening party at around 3 pm on Tuesday, Jun 29. The jawans tried to defend which resulted in the fierce gunbattle which lasted for three hours.
The troops were from the 39th battalion of the force and were a part of its 'E' and 'F' companies, informed CRPF DG Vikram Srivastava. The death toll could increased as the casualties are higher. The injured were rushed to Jagdalpur's Maharani Hospital.
The bodies of the deceased were brought to Raipur. The postmortem will be done in Raipur.
